Job Description:

The Employee Experience Specialist supports the design and delivery of programs that help people feel included, supported, and able to grow at Cityblock. This role requires a mission-driven individual who can balance competing priorities by choosing paths that align with our service to members and inclusive internal processes.

Partnering closely across the Talent, Learning, and Experience team, you will apply a proactive approach to initiatives across culture, recognition, engagement, and leadership development. You will translate evolving strategies into actionable work, ensuring Cityblock’s values and Employee Value Proposition (EVP) are consistently reflected in the employee lifecycle.

Responsibilities

Strategy & Execution

  • Lead the design and execution of employee experience strategies that advance belonging and engagement, using innovation to thoughtfully challenge assumptions and apply creative problem-solving to ambiguous work.

  • Support writing and submission of external culture-related awards, ensuring Cityblock’s external brand is a reflection of our internal engaged culture.

  • Solve problems using judgment and technical experience to ensure programs stay on track and aligned with broader goals.

Onboarding & Early Experience

  • Partner with the Learning Program Manager to design and update the New Hire Orientation program. Serve as the primary facilitator, adapting your communication style to bridge gaps and ensure a welcoming experience for all Cityfolx. Manage new hire onboarding program logistics and communications.

  • Facilitate structured check-ins with new hires to provide clarity and connection, translating Cityblock’s broader goals into clear, actionable understanding for new employees. Partner with Talent Acquisition on our New Hire survey strategy, and analyze trends from onboarding surveys to continuously improve the onboarding experience.

  • Coordinate with cross-functional partners to improve how teams work together during the onboarding transition.

Recognition

  • Day to day owner of Cityblock’s online recognition platform. Track online recognition trends and use data to evaluate impact. Develop and launch campaigns that drive engagement while holding the program to reliably high standards. Partner with VP of Talent on recognition strategy and manager of Benefits on vendor management.

  • Facilitate nominated recognition programs end-to-end, including communications, platform setup, coordination of review processes, and reward fulfillment

Listening, Insights & Continuous Improvement

  • Develop communications for engagement surveys and support the synthesis of data.

  • Work with People Business Partners to identify areas of the business requiring engagement support and action. Use employee feedback to inform program adjustments, pushing through discomfort to deliver results in evolving territory.

  • Apply a general understanding of business drivers to ensure experience recommendations improve internal processes.

Learning & Development

  • Support the facilitation and coordination of leadership programs.

  • Provide program logistics support ensuring a seamless participant experience across all learning initiatives.

Requirements for the Role

  • Education: Bachelor’s degree required.
  • Experience: 3-5 years of professional experience in a fast-paced or people-centric environment.
